投资 - 指标介绍:MA、WMA、EMA
移动平均线,是交易者们最青睐的用来衡量动能或趋势的工具。
常用的有三种均线:简单移动平均线、加权移动平均线和指数移动平均线。
每种平均线的公式不同,作用也不同。
简单移动平均线Simple Moving Average
在计算机出现之前,简单移动平均线(SMA)很盛行,因为它很容易计算。今天的处理能力已经使其他类型的移动平均线和技术指标更容易测量。移动平均线是根据特定时期的平均收盘价计算的。移动平均线通常使用每日收盘价,但它也可以为其他时间框架计算。也可以使用其他价格数据,如开盘价或中间价。新一天的收盘价出现,该数据被添加到计算中,而用来计算平均值的一系列的数据中最早的价格数据被剔除。
只不过一般收盘价对第二天的价格影响最大,所以一般使用收盘价,这样更能体现出一定的预测性。
Moving average, 前面判断趋势时用到过。比如MA100, 指的是100日的均线。计算方法是几日均线,就是从当天开始向前开始几日价格的平均。
对于简单的移动平均线,其计算公式为某一时期的数据点之和除以时期数。
例如,2014年6月20日至26日,苹果公司(AAPL)的收盘价如下:
Date |
Closing Price of AAPL |
June 26 |
$90.90 |
June 25 |
$90.36 |
June 24 |
$90.28 |
June 23 |
$90.83 |
June 20 |
$90.91 |
基于上述价格的五期移动平均线,将用以下公式计算:
这里:Pn = 当期价格,即每日的收盘价。
代入数值计算为:
(90.90+90.36+90.28+90.83+90.91)/5 = 90.656
上面的方程式显示,所列期间的平均价格为90.66美元。所以6.26当天的5日均线,MA5指标的值为90.66美元,就形成一个点,然后将每天的5日均线值的点连起来,就是5日均线。
每天的MA5的值就是前四天和今天的收盘价的平均值。
使用移动平均数是消除强烈价格波动的有效方法。关键的限制是,来自较早数据的数据点与靠近数据集开始的数据点的权重没有任何不同。这就是加权移动平均线发挥作用的地方。
使用了均线,就更容易找到股价的support level支撑和阻力resistance level位置。
短期的均线,比如5日均线,会波动更大一些,而长期均线,比如250日均线,就会更加平滑。
使用平均值这种最简单的数学计算方法,就是为了让投资者investors和交易者traders能够跟踪和识别趋势,通过一天天的波动转化为平滑的曲线。
股价本来就有随机波动性,就像测量某个数据会有误差一样,使用了平均值,能更好的过滤波动。
加权移动平均数Weighted Moving Average
加权移动平均数对最新价格赋予了更大的权重,因为它们比前面的价格相关性更强。加权的总和应该加到1(或100%)。而在简单移动平均数的情况下,权重是平均分配的。
举个例子,
Date |
Closing Price of AAPL |
Weighting权重 |
June 26 |
$90.90 |
5/15 |
June 25 |
$90.36 |
4/15 |
June 24 |
$90.28 |
3/15 |
June 23 |
$90.83 |
2/15 |
June 20 |
$90.91 |
1/15 |
公式是:
这里,n是周期,比如WMA5,就是5天的加权移动平均值。
计算的结果是6.26日当天的WMA5值为90.62美元。
具体的权重,也可以自行调整。
因加权移动平均线强调将愈近期的价格比重提升,故当市场行情突变时,加权移动平均线比起其它平均线更容易预测价格波动。
通过调整权重,还有不同的加权移动平均线种类和公式,上面介绍的是线性加权移动平均Linear WMA。
还有末日WMA:
梯型加权移动平均线:
[(第1日收盘价+第2日收盘价)×1+(第2日收盘价+第3日收盘价)×2+(第3日收盘价+第4日收盘价)×3+(第4日收盘价+第5日收盘价)×4]/(2×1+2×2+2×3+2×4),即为第五日的阶梯加权移动平均线。
平方系数加权移动平均线:
MA=[(第1日收盘价×1×1)+( 第2日收盘价×2×2)+( 第3日收盘价×3×3)+( 第4日收盘价×4×4)+( 第5日收盘价×5×5)]/(1×1+2×2+3×3+4×4+5×5)
指数平滑移动平均线Exponential Moving Averages
EMA(Eponential Moving Average)是指数移动平均值。也叫 EXPMA 指标,它也是一种趋向类指标,指数移动平均值是以指数式递减加权的移动平均。
其计算公式中着重考虑了当天价格(当期)行情的权重。
而之所以叫做指数平滑移动平均线的原因,是因为直接定义式是使用了指数参与计算:
这个定义比较复杂,一般需要推导公式时才使用,我们一般不用,而是用递推形式的。
递推定义式:
使用递推公式来计算。第一天EMA的值就是x1。
xn是最新的当天价格,N为周期比如5日EMA均线N就是5。
举个例子:5日EMA计算。
Date |
Closing Price of AAPL |
EMA |
June 26 |
$90.90 |
$90.68 |
June 25 |
$90.36 |
$90.57 |
June 24 |
$90.28 |
$90.68 |
June 23 |
$90.83 |
$90.88 |
June 20 |
$90.91 |
$90.91 |
EMA的值:
6.20,值和当天收盘价一样,$90.91。
6.23,(2*90.83 + (5-1)*90.91)/(5+1) = 90.88
6.24, (2*90.28 + (5-1)*90.88)/(5+1) = 90.68
6.25, (2*90.36 + (5-1)*90.68)/(5+1) = 90.57
6.26, (2*90.90 + (5-1)*90.57)/(5+1) = 90.68
使用EMA可以更好的描述趋势变化的快慢。比如在MACD就是用EMA。
正是使用了移动平均线,才能体现出短期和长期的价格变化趋势。并通过短期均线上穿或下穿长期均线,体现出趋势的转变。
哪种移动平均线更有效?
由于指数型移动平均线(EMA)使用指数加权的乘数来给最近的价格以更大的权重,一些人认为与WMA或SMA相比,它是一个更好的趋势指标。有些人认为,EMA对趋势的变化反应更灵敏。另一方面,SMA所提供的更基本的平滑作用可能使它在寻找图表上的简单支撑和阻力区域时更加有效。一般来说,移动平均线作用是平滑价格数据,否则会有在图表上的噪音。
EMA和WMA的功能是相似的,它们更依赖于最近的价格,而对较早的价格重视程度较低。如果交易员担心数据的滞后影响可能会降低移动平均线指标的反应能力,他们会使用这些EMA和WMA而不是SMA。
所有的移动平均线都有一个明显的缺点,即它们是滞后指标。由于移动平均线是基于先前的数据,它们在反映趋势变化之前会受到时间滞后的影响。在移动平均线显示出趋势变化之前,股票价格可能会急剧波动。较短的移动平均线比长的移动平均线受到的滞后影响要小。
不过,这种滞后对于某些被称为移动平均线交叉的技术指标来说还是很有用的。被称为死亡交叉的技术指标发生在50日均线与200日均线的交叉之下,它被认为是一个看跌信号。一个相反的指标,被称为黄金交叉,是在50日均线与200日均线交叉时产生的,它被认为是一个看涨信号。
参考:
Moving Average (MA), Weighted MA, and Exponential MAhttps://www.investopedia.com/ask/answers/071414/whats-difference-between-moving-average-and-weighted-moving-average.asp
投资 - 指标介绍:MA、WMA、EMA相关推荐
- 投资 - 指标介绍: MACD
概念 MACD称为异同移动平均线Moving Average Convergence / Divergence,提出者是Gerald Appel,提出时间是1979年2月4日. 这套技术方法,是基于价 ...
- MA、EMA、SMA、DMA、TMA、WMA
MA.EMA.SMA.DMA.TMA.WMA 6种平均算法经常在各种指标公式中运用,但多数初学者可能并不理解其具体区别,整理如下: MA(X,N)简单算术平均 求X的N日移动平均值,不分轻重,平均算. ...
- 【原生代码】Python3 实现ATR、MA、EMA、SMMA、RMA、TEMA指标的计算
1. 参数说明 r:K线数据,字典或者数组 days:指标长度 name:使用哪一个字段,填'Close'即可,如果不填则代表r是数组而不是字典 变量r 字典结构图如下: {{'Time': 0,'C ...
- MA、EMA、MACD、BOLL、KDJ指标计算
MA.EMA.MACD.BOLL.KDJ指标计算 # encoding:utf-8 import os import sys import pandas as qh_pd import time im ...
- MA、EMA、SMA的区别
MA(X,N)简单算术平均 求X的N日移动平均值,不分轻重,平均算.算法是: (X1+X2+X3+-..+Xn)/N ...
- 【高并发】- 指标介绍
什么是高并发 高并发系统有哪些关键指标 高并发系统介绍 本文主要讲解高并发系统的概念,在实际开发过程中为什么要使用高并发系统,相比于传统系统,能带来怎样的改变. 1.1 高并发介绍 高并发(Hign ...
- 域格模块移动网络信号指标介绍
域格模块移动网络信号指标介绍 如今,移动通信已成为我们生活不可或缺的一部分,我们享受着他带给我们的便利,也不时遭遇到因网络通信质量差造成的窘境.而带给我们这冰火两重天的,就是我们今天的主角&qu ...
- kdj指标主要看哪个值_KDJ指标介绍及看盘看点(图解)
KDJ是目前股市使用很频繁的指标,该指标具有很强的指导作用,下面将对该指标进行介绍. KDJ指标介绍 KDJ的中文名称是随机指数,该指标是由乔治-莱思首创的,它是通过当日或最近几日的最高价.最低价及收 ...
- KDJ指标介绍及看盘看点(图解)
KDJ是目前股市使用很频繁的指标,该指标具有很强的指导作用,下面将对该指标进行介绍. KDJ指标介绍 KDJ的中文名称是随机指数,该指标是由乔治-莱思首创的,它是通过当日或最近几日的最高价.最低价及收 ...
最新文章
- 深度优先算法回溯实例
- mysql+drdb+HA
- jQuery :nth-child前有无空格的区别
- 1986年讲MDCT的基础性论文
- python横坐标如何显示为月份_如何显示给定两个日期之间的所有月份?
- SparkSQL之External Data
- supersocke接收不到数据_基于SuperSocket的北斗终端数据接收服务的设计与实现
- quartus管脚分配后需要保存吗_电脑磁盘显示未分配怎么办?磁盘数据如何恢复?...
- display: inline-block;水平居中
- visualvm连接服务器jvm进行监控
- PhoneGap插件开发实例
- Kafka权威指南总结
- 【CS285 深度强化学习 】作业一之详解 [Deep Reinforcement Learning]
- 可达性分析算法代码举例
- 如果物联网平台一直不盈利,行业集体该怎么活?
- 3到5年工作经验是如何回答面试中被问到的Java集合框架问题
- 电影《当幸福来敲门》英语台词
- 光学雨量计对比翻斗式雨量计的优势
- Pygame 简单打字游戏
- 关于Python爬虫种类、法律、轮子的一二三